And He answered and said, "It is not good to take the children's bread and throw it to the dogs." (NASB ©1995)

dogs. [Tois kunarion,] 'to the little dogs,' lap dogs, etc. the diminutive of [kuon,] a dog. The Jews, while they boasted of being the children of God, gave the name of dogs to the heathen, for their idolatry, etc.
